First Renaissance Clubsport Opens and Travel is No Longer an Excuse to Skip Workouts

Calling all health-nuts, meatheads and normal people who enjoy working out: the first two Renaissance ClubSport properties have opened in Cali -- the first in Walnut Creek and the second more recently in Aliso Viejo corporate park.

Marriott and NorCal health club development firm Leisure Sports, Inc. have teamed up to create the new concept, which essentially boasts the same higher-end features of most Renaissance properties with monster fitness offerings.

Active.com had the scoop:

Because the hotel's fitness facility doubles as a full-fledged health club for locals, hotel guests benefit from complimentary access to a gaggle of cardio and strength machines, literally a ton of free weights, a multitude of classes (e.g., yoga, cycling, aerobics, dance, pilates, etc.), and a competition-quality outdoor 25-meter lap pool.

If all those hard bodies and shiny machines don't guilt you into working out while you're traveling, you can bribe yourself to work out with the promise of a massage from the R spa after your sweat session.

Hopefully, as the 20+ of these planned ClubSport properties continue to roll out, travelers' bellies will begin to stop rolling over their jeans.
